#include "openmm/serialization/HarmonicAngleForceProxy.h"
#include "openmm/serialization/SerializationNode.h"
#include "openmm/Force.h"
#include "openmm/HarmonicAngleForce.h"
#include <sstream>
using namespace OpenMM;
using namespace std;
HarmonicAngleForceProxy::HarmonicAngleForceProxy() : SerializationProxy("HarmonicAngleForce") {
}
void HarmonicAngleForceProxy::serialize(const void* object, SerializationNode& node) const {
const HarmonicAngleForce& force = *reinterpret_cast<const HarmonicAngleForce*>(object);
SerializationNode& bonds = node.createChildNode("Angles");
for (int i = 0; i < force.getNumAngles(); i++) {
int particle1, particle2, particle3;
double angle, k;
force.getAngleParameters(i, particle1, particle2, particle3, angle, k);
bonds.createChildNode("Angle").setIntProperty("p1", particle1).setIntProperty("p2", particle2).setIntProperty("p3", particle3).setDoubleProperty("a", angle).setDoubleProperty("k", k);
}
}
void* HarmonicAngleForceProxy::deserialize(const SerializationNode& node) const {
HarmonicAngleForce* force = new HarmonicAngleForce();
try {
const SerializationNode& bonds = node.getChildNode("Angles");
for (int i = 0; i < (int) bonds.getChildren().size(); i++) {
const SerializationNode& constraint = bonds.getChildren()[i];
force->addAngle(constraint.getDoubleProperty("p1"), constraint.getDoubleProperty("p2"), constraint.getDoubleProperty("p3"), constraint.getDoubleProperty("a"), constraint.getDoubleProperty("k"));
}
}
catch (...) {
delete force;
throw;
}
return force;
}

#include "../../../tests/AssertionUtilities.h"
#include "openmm/HarmonicAngleForce.h"
#include "openmm/serialization/XmlSerializer.h"
#include <iostream>
#include <sstream>
using namespace OpenMM;
using namespace std;
void testSerialization() {
// Create a Force.
HarmonicAngleForce force;
force.addAngle(0, 1, 2, 1.0, 2.0);
force.addAngle(0, 2, 3, 2.0, 2.1);
force.addAngle(2, 3, 4, 3.0, 2.2);
force.addAngle(5, 1, 2, 4.0, 2.3);
// Serialize and then deserialize it.
stringstream buffer;
XmlSerializer::serialize<HarmonicAngleForce>(&force, "Force", buffer);
HarmonicAngleForce* copy = XmlSerializer::deserialize<HarmonicAngleForce>(buffer);
// Compare the two systems to see if they are identical.
HarmonicAngleForce& force2 = *copy;
ASSERT_EQUAL(force.getNumAngles(), force2.getNumAngles());
for (int i = 0; i < force.getNumAngles(); i++) {
int a1, a2, a3, b1, b2, b3;
double da, db, ka, kb;
force.getAngleParameters(i, a1, a2, a3, da, ka);
force.getAngleParameters(i, b1, b2, b3, db, kb);
ASSERT_EQUAL(a1, b1);
ASSERT_EQUAL(a2, b2);
ASSERT_EQUAL(a3, b3);
ASSERT_EQUAL(da, db);
ASSERT_EQUAL(ka, kb);
}
}
int main() {
try {
testSerialization();
}
catch(const exception& e) {
cout << "exception: " << e.what() << endl;
return 1;
}
cout << "Done" << endl;
return 0;
}
